Anthony Bajada has been named Director of Operations & Facilities at ctPark Ltd, he announced on Thursday.

“Looking forward to working alongside and also leading a talented team, driving operational excellence,” he said.

Mr Bajada added that he is “grateful for this opportunity” and is “excited for what’s to come”.

In his new role at ctPark Ltd, he will be tasked with strategic planning, operations, facility management, project management, and also leading the operations department’s team.

Prior to his new position, he spent over 12 years at Methode Electronics Malta, most recently working as Project Launch Manager. In that role, he was entrusted with the execution of new product programme launches focused within the automotive sector. His other roles at the company include Production Principal and Managing Principal, among others.

Aside from that, he also spent more than a year as a Consultant in development and business planning on a part-time basis.

He holds a Bachelor of Arts in Management from Global College Malta, together with a Higher National Diploma in Mechanical Engineering from MCAST, among other qualifications. Mr Bajada describes himself as being “driven to change” and “passionate to lead”.

ctPark Ltd is a parking and traffic management company that has now become “synonymous with the development of the industry” in Malta through a number of public and Government contracts for traffic management and parking systems.
